    The food is ok, would give it 3 stars. However, this one star review is not for food, but an…read moreinfection control issue. We came for dinner, and we were seated by the door. I was seated where I am facing towards the kitchen. From there, I could see what the waitress is doing. So, as soon as we enter the restaurant, I already noticed the waitress wearing gloves (blue latex kind). I could tell that she has been wearing it for a while. (I work in the healthcare field and see people don gloves on a daily basis). The waitress is busy, since she was by herself, going from table to table, from kitchen to tables, serving them food, giving them plates, silverware, napkins, getting their payments, touching everything from door handles to pitchers to fill glasses with water, to cleaning the tables with rags - all while wearing the same pair of gloves. That is a serious infection control issue, especially because she is touching the plates containing the food which the customers eat. I hope she will practice glove and hand hygiene, since a lot of people come here.
